The Importance of Decentralization in Bitcoin Mining

Bitcoin was designed with decentralization at its core. One of the most critical aspects of this decentralization lies in Bitcoin mining, the process by which new bitcoins are created and transactions are validated. However, as mining has evolved, concerns over centralization have grown, making it essential to highlight the importance of maintaining a decentralized mining network.
The Risks of Centralized Mining
Over the years, Bitcoin mining has shifted from hobbyist participation to large-scale operations dominated by powerful mining pools and industrial mining farms. While this evolution has increased efficiency, it has also led to concerns regarding centralization. Some of the key risks associated with centralized mining include:
- Network Vulnerability: If a small number of entities control the majority of mining power, they could theoretically execute a 51% attack, allowing them to manipulate transactions, double-spend coins, or disrupt the network.
- Regulatory Risks: Mining centralization in specific regions increases the risk of government intervention or regulatory crackdowns that could affect the entire network.
- Reduced Trust and Security: Bitcoin’s security relies on a distributed, trustless system. If mining becomes too centralized, it compromises the very foundation of Bitcoin’s reliability and censorship resistance.
- Barriers to Entry: If mining becomes dominated by a few large players, it discourages smaller miners and new participants, limiting decentralization further.
The Benefits of Decentralized Mining
A well-distributed mining network provides numerous benefits, reinforcing Bitcoin’s long-term viability and resilience:
- Increased Security: The more distributed the mining power, the harder it is for any single entity to gain control and attack the network.
- Censorship Resistance: A decentralized mining structure ensures that no government or organization can easily control or censor transactions.
- Network Stability: With miners spread globally, Bitcoin remains resistant to localized failures, such as power outages, regulations, or geopolitical conflicts.
- Fairer Participation: A decentralized approach ensures that mining remains open to more participants, preventing an oligopolistic system that favours only the biggest players.
How to Promote Decentralization in Mining
To mitigate centralization risks, several strategies and innovations can be employed:
- Encouraging More Individual Miners: With advancements in energy-efficient mining hardware and alternative mining methods, individuals can still participate in mining.
- Decentralized Mining Pools: Mining pools should operate transparently and distribute control among participants rather than centralizing decision-making power.
- Geographical Distribution: Promoting mining in various regions reduces reliance on a single country or jurisdiction.
- Development of New Consensus Mechanisms: Research into alternative consensus models, such as hybrid proof-of-work/proof-of-stake systems, could enhance Bitcoin’s decentralization.
